Mazda cuts electrification investment by 25%, expands hybrid lineup and launch Thai-made SUV in Japan as all-new CX-3
Mazda cuts electrification investment by 25%, expands hybrid lineup and launch Thai-made SUV in Japan as all-new CX-3 Mazda Motor Corporation (Mazda) announced on May 12 that it will reduce its electrification-related investment by 2030 to the level of JPY 1.2 trillion. This represents a 25% reduction from the plan announced in March 2025, taking into account factors such as the slowdown in electric vehicle (EV) sales in the US market. The compan...

Mazda Reports 72.3% decrease in operating profit for fiscal year 2025, remains profitable
Mazda Reports 72.3% decrease in operating profit for fiscal year 2025, remains profitable Mazda announced its full-year financial results for fiscal year 2025 on May 12. Revenue decreased 2.0% year-on-year to JPY 4,918.2 billion, operating profit fell 72.3% year-on-year to JPY 51.6 billion, and net income attributable to owners of the parent decreased 69.2% year-on-year to JPY 35.1 billion. Amid uncertainties such as the impact of US tariffs, g...

Mazda to end sales of Mazda2 in Japan as early as July
Mazda to end sales of Mazda2 in Japan as early as July Mazda Motor Corporation (Mazda) will end sales of its Mazda2 compact car in Japan as early as July 2026. Mazda is not likely to introduce a successor to the model in Japan for the time being. The Mazda2 played a key role in broadening Mazda's appeal as an affordable compact car, but sales had been sluggish in recent years due to its long model lifecycle. Mazda will continue the production and...

Aisin begins production of six-speed automatic transmissions for Mazda with dedicated production line
Aisin begins production of six-speed automatic transmissions for Mazda with dedicated production line Aisin Corporation (Aisin) announced on April 21 that it has begun contract production of six-speed automatic transmissions (ATs) in the U.S. for Mazda Motor Corporation (Mazda). This is the first production subcontracted from Mazda. Aisin’s consolidated subsidiary in the U.S., Aisin Drivetrain, Inc., will manufacture the six-speed ATs. The subs...
